## 5.1.0 — Changed defaults

Heads up: Fanfare's notification fan-out now applies backpressure way earlier. We kept seeing downstream push workers tip over during big broadcast sends, so the queue watermarks and shed thresholds moved to more conservative defaults. Most tenants won't notice anything except smoother spikes. If you'd tuned the old values, re-check your overrides before promoting this release. The new shipped defaults are as follows.

config for bahop-fajep:
DRUATH_PIN=4501
DRUATH_TENANT=briwyn
DRUATH_METRICS_HOST=metrics.druath.brasksoft.test
DRUATH_SEAL=seal_7d2e069d
DRUATH_STANDBY_TEAM=olieth

Subject: Undo/redo sync for DiagramDen — weekly notes

Hi Tethervale team,

Quick update for the sync: undo/redo in DiagramDen now uses operation logs instead of full snapshots, so your plugin should replay inverse ops rather than restoring state blobs. Redo stacks clear on any remote edit — known quirk, fix is in review. Grouped moves count as one undo step now, which should fix the jitter you reported. To test against our staging op-log endpoint, authenticate with the token below.

session JWT of yahif-bawig = eyJhbGciOiJIUzI1NiIsInR5cCI6IkpXVCJ9.eyJzdWIiOiIaWAxmMIn0.GYffpIaj

Finance Review Summary — Gross-Margin Review, H1

For sales leads: the half-year review shows blended gross margin at 41.8%, down 1.6 points. The decline traces mainly to discounting on the Arbalest product line and elevated freight on the Tornquay routes. Margins on the Veridia services bundle improved to 58%, offsetting part of the slide. Discount approvals above 15% now require sign-off from Henrik Solberg's team. The confidential item concerning next year's pricing strategy is set out immediately below.

board note of fafog-yahap: Project Rusdor slips by a full year because of the audit delay.